How to make Fresh Green Bean Casserole Directions

Get all the ingredients on your workbench. Slice the onion, beans, and mushrooms if they didn’t come already cut. Dice the garlic. Get an ungreased 9×13 casserole pan.

Add oil to a large cast iron pan and saute the green beans, turning frequently until they have softened. They will turn bright green, then darken, and they may char a bit on the outside. Add onions, mushrooms, and garlic, then cover the top to trap the heat so the beans will cook faster. This will take about 20 minutes.

When the green beans are dark and tasty, with translucent onions and creamy mushrooms, remove all of them and put them in the 9×13 pan to the side. Leave the straggling mushrooms in the pan. Next, we will make cream of mushroom to go on top.

Keep the heat on the pan and add butter. Let it melt a bit, then add flour. Whisk them together and start adding milk a splash at a time. Whisk more and more until it becomes a thick paste. Add milk every time it thickens to a mush or paste until 4 cups are added. Add salt and pepper. This takes about 20 minutes.

Once the cream of mushroom is made, add it to the green bean mix in the dish. Fold it in until it covers all of the pan. At this point, you can cover with a lid or plastic and cook until it’s time to eat, or you can cook immediately. Add bacon or crispy fried onions to the top, then bake at 375 degrees for 20-25 minutes. Yum!! Enjoy! There is nothing like real cream of mushroom to make a meal more savory!

Storing and other details on this casserole

To store beforehand, cover with a lid or plastic wrap, leaving off all the toppings (unless it is completely cooled) and adding them later when ready to cook. When ready to cook, take it out, remove the plastic top, and cook at 375 for 25 minutes.

To freeze: Yes, you can! But if you plan on making this within a couple of days (even three days!), you DON’T have to freeze it. This is only if you have extras or want it for another event in a few weeks. Ensure a lid is on or wrapped in foil and plastic to protect from freezer burn and that it is cool enough to go into the freezer.

  • Make the green beans as stiff or as soft as you like them. Play by your rules!
  • If the cream of mushroom sauce is too thick, add up to 1 more cup of milk.
  • Toppings are completely optional, but they are such a great addition.
  • Leftovers are good for a week if kept in the refrigerator and with a lid on.

Ingredients

  • 2 Tbsp 2 vegetable oil

  • 2 Lbs 2 Fresh-cut French green beans

  • 16 Oz 16 sliced Bella mushrooms

  • 1 Large 1 sweet yellow onion, thinly sliced

  • 1 Clove 1 garlic, diced

  • mushroom roux
  • 1/4th Cup 1/4th butter

  • 1/4th Cup 1/4th flour

  • 5 Cups 5 whole milk

  • 1 1/2 Tsp 1 1/2 salt (add more to taste)

  • 1 1/2 Tsp 1 1/2 pepper

  • crispy fried onions (sub fried jalapeños)

  • cooked, crunchy bacon, torn
